'Antiques Detective' describes how to tell a genuine piece from a fake and spot signs that indicate an object has been restored. It includes expert advice on makers, questions to ask, tips for identifying the best examples in furniture, ceramics, glass, silver, dolls, teddy bears, textiles and more.

Judith Miller began as a regular contributor to newspapers and magazines, including BBC Homes and Antiques and Financial Times. Her TV work includes The House Detectives, The Antiques Trail, The Martha Stewart Show, and BBC's long-running Antiques Roadshow. With more than 100 books to her name, other DK titles by Judith include Furniture and Buy, Keep or Sell. She has also lectured extensively, including at the V&A in London and the Smithsonian in Washington. She lives in London.
Antiques expert Miller has amassed a wealth of information about antiques in her latest book, part of the "Collector's Guide Series" from DK. Covering furniture, ceramics, glass, metalware and collectibles, Miller is guilty of both overreaching and under-performing; that said, she has put together a sound introduction to several areas. Particularly in her overview of major styles and their specifics, such as chairs from the 18th century to the Arts and Craft movement, Miller is confident and informative; however, a less-than-clear presentation and fuzzy details (is the dollar amount cited next to a particular item retail price, value price or original cost?) will frustrate. First published in the UK, American audiences will find several significant gaps: her expertise seems to skew toward the 18th and 19th centuries, leaving America's Art Deco, Art Nouveau and Modern collectors out; for instance, focusing in depth on "18th Century wine glasses," Miller barely mentions pressed or carnival glass. A Photofit section is quite helpful but hardly comprehensive (a section on silver marks doesn't show Paul Revere's, one of the most widely sought-and imitated-of American antiques). Still, beginners and novices will find much to appreciate here, especially if their interests happen to line up with Miller's. Photographs.
